Ratio Lattice Visualizer

An interactive 3D lattice for exploring just-intonation ratios through prime factors.

An interactive React and Three.js visualization that represents musical ratios as points in a spatial lattice. Each ratio is positioned according to its prime-factor structure, making it possible to compare intervals, chords, and harmonic regions visually.

Transformational Tonnetz

An interactive Tonnetz for exploring transformations between major and minor triads.

A React, TypeScript, and SVG web app for visualizing triadic relationships on a Tonnetz. The tool lets users select chords, show transformational relations, adjust the view, and trace paths through harmonic progressions.
